Web21 mrt. 2024 · How to work out pro-rata holiday. The quickest and easiest way to work out the holiday entitlement for your part-time staff is to multiply the number of days they work each week by 5.6. For example, if a pro-rata employee works two days a week, their statutory holiday entitlement will be 2 x 5.6, or 11.2 days. Web1.2 How do you calculate a term time only (TTO) salary? Web12 aug. 2024 · A worker is entitled to be paid in respect of any period of annual leave to which he is entitled under regulations 13 and 13A, at the rate of a week’s pay in respect of each week of leave. Also applicable to holiday and pay is the definition of a ‘weeks pay’ set out in the Employment Rights Act 1996 – sections 221-224.
